One significant opportunity in the 5G Base Station Market is the rise of small cell deployment in urban areas. Small cells enhance network capacity and coverage, particularly in high-density regions where macro base stations alone cannot efficiently manage traffic. The increasing demand for ultra-low latency applications such as augmented reality, virtual reality, and autonomous vehicles drives the adoption of small cell solutions. This trend offers equipment manufacturers and service providers the chance to expand their product portfolios and provide innovative solutions tailored to urban infrastructure requirements. Moreover, the integration of small cells with existing macro networks enables seamless connectivity, optimizing network performance and reliability.

Technological advancements are creating opportunities for new entrants and established players in the 5G Base Station Market. Open RAN (Radio Access Network) architecture is transforming the market by enabling multi-vendor interoperability, reducing deployment costs, and fostering innovation. Open RAN allows operators to mix and match hardware and software components, creating a competitive environment for equipment manufacturers and encouraging startups to participate in the market. Additionally, the integration of AI and machine learning in base station operations provides opportunities to optimize network performance, predictive maintenance, and energy efficiency, resulting in cost savings and enhanced user experience. Companies investing in these innovations can gain a competitive edge and capture a larger market share.
